Snow Characteristics Comments

North slopes had 6" of powder on a hard rain crust. West slopes were ice or breakable crust that warmed to glop in the afternoon. South exposures had great corn skiing on a 4" supportable M/F crust. Yes corn skiing in February.

Red Flags Comments
Only red flag was the rapid warming from a low in the 20's. Although our last run was around 1430hrs. and did not produce roller balls. Just fine corn skiing. Skied between 8320" and 7600".

Problem #1 Comments

I suppose if this heat keeps up and we do not get a great refreeze tonight we could see a few wet slabs or point releases coming down tomorrow afternoon.
